Mobileye Review — Autonomous Vehicle Technology
Mobileye provides vision-based ADAS and autonomous driving tech to enhance vehicle safety and automation.
Mobileye excels in vision-based autonomous driving tech with strong safety features but limited public pricing details.
- Industry-leading vision-based ADAS technology
- Proprietary EyeQ chip for real-time processing
- Strong focus on vehicle safety and collision avoidance
- Limited public pricing and plan details
- No public API or developer platform access
Is Mobileye Right for You?
A quick checklist to help you decide.
Ideal for: Automotive manufacturers, fleet operators, and developers focused on integrating advanced vision-based ADAS and autonomous driving systems.
Less suited for: Individual developers or small startups needing transparent pricing or standalone software solutions without hardware integration.
Bottom line: Proven vision-based ADAS technology with hardware-software integration for automotive safety and autonomy.
